Thaxterogaster caesiophylloides is a species of fungus in family Cortinariaceae.[1]

Taxonomy

It was described as new to science in 2014 and classified as Cortinarius caesiophylloides. It was placed in the (subgenus Phlegmacium) of the large mushroom genus Cortinarius.[2]

In 2022 the species was transferred from Cortinarius and reclassified as Thaxterogaster caesiophylloides based on genomic data.[3]

Etymology

The specific epithet caesiophylloides alludes to both its similarity to Cortinarius multiformis var. caesiophyllus (now named C. caesiolamellatus), and the bluish tints in the gills.[2]

Habitat and distribution

Found in Fennoscandia, where it grows on the ground in mesic coniferous forests.[2] It has since been found in Slovakia.[4]
